#### Advanced options
These are the available advanced options you can use:
- `update(data) {return ...}` to customize the value that is set in the vue property, for example if the field names don't match
- `result(data)` is a hook called when a result is received
- `error(errors, type)` is a hook called when there are errors, `type` value can either be `'sending'` or `'execution'`
- `update(data) {return ...}` to customize the value that is set in the vue property, for example if the field names don't match.
- `result(data)` is a hook called when a result is received.
- `error(error)` is a hook called when there are errors, `error` being an Apollo error object with either a `graphQLErrors` property or a `networkError` property.
- `loadingKey` will update the component data property you pass as the value. You should initialize this property to `0` in the component `data()` hook. When the query is loading, this property will be incremented by 1 and as soon as it no longer is, the property will be decremented by 1. That way, the property can represent a counter of currently loading queries.
- `watchLoading(isLoading, countModifier)` is a hook called when the loading state of the query changes. The `countModifier` parameter is either equal to `1` when the query is now loading, or `-1` when the query is no longer loading.
